[QUOTE="thebarnman, post: 258380, member: 6642"] Hey Dave, we connected, but the game is not starting. I'm Goldendollarguy on TPA by the way. At least it was interesting having a match found between the two of us. For the first time I saw there was 2 in queue. In trying to get something started; I exited out and came back in, and the program crashed. When I came back; it said 0 in queue. Oh well...hopefully they'll get this worked on. By the way, the thing I've been meaning to mention is if I select Gorgar and try to find a on-line match; I've found there is no way to deselect Gorgar without having to first exit out of Pinball Arcade and selecting Online Play again. Doing this is usually how the game crashes...(though not every time.) It would be nice if there's a way to switch certain pinball tables without having to exit out of the lobby, and back in again. In one thought: I wonder when it shows 1 in Queue; if it's not in fact indicating that it's me (another words counting me as being the one in Queue.) If there's a glitch with that part of it; that might be a big part of the issue of no games connecting. Also asked of us is our connection speed earlier in this thread. According to speedtest.net the Ping 1ms; Download 166.49Mbps, and Upload 12.04Mbps. So in this case connection is probably not an issue. An interesting point I'm discovering is if there is one or two in queue; I've found if I totally exit out of Pinball Arcade, and then restart it; I then find there is 0 in Queue. That makes me wonder if when it shows one or two in queue...if it's just old information not yet updated? The Queue information may not be accurate. [/QUOTE]
